8 ways to build a brand via web design

July 11, 2016 By Team Impossible Leave a Comment

8 ways to build a brand via web design

As a part of your internet marketing effort, branding helps customers to realize that they can trust a specific brand or business. A brand that you create not only brings customers in, but also helps to retain them. Branding is more than the creation of a unique name or image for your products.

Branding and web design need each other. The layout of a website highlights the uniqueness of a brand. Unfortunately, many business owners fail to realize that branding also depends on web design. You can create or destroy a brand through web design.

Consider the following measures if you desire to build a brand using web design:

Colour

The right colour palette is crucial for branding. Colour helps to create an identity. It’s easier for customers to identify your brand based on the colours with which they associate it. Colour enhances aesthetics. Colour stimulates emotions. Colour links the subconscious with many things.

Character

A brand needs a strong character via web design. Not forgetting, having a strong character is not the only element that helps in building your brand online.

Emotion

It’s impossible to brand or rebrand your company while leaving the emotion element out. You must identify the emotions as well as feelings that you want customers to experience whenever they visit your site. Emotion means enabling customers to associate your brand with specific things or traits.

Consistency

Consistency here means creating a brand that stays long in the memory of your customers. A consistent brand has a much higher chance of succeeding regardless of the level of competition that exists within its industry. Your website must bear uniformity in every way.

Sizing and positioning the logo

The upper left area on your page is the designated place for your brand’s logo. Every person visiting your website is likely to check the upper left area. The size is equally important as it determines whether your customers can see the logo or not.

Value proposition

The website should give customers value for money. Most customers spend the first few minutes orienting themselves with all aspects of the website. Some of them go straight to the information they want. The value proposition needs to be both clear and concise.

Tone of voice

The tone of voice or language used in the website must reinforce the personality as well as the character of your brand. The language or tone of voice also depends on the target audience that you are looking for.

Uniqueness

A successful brand has to be unique. It must not be a copy of an existing brand. In this regard, your website also needs to be unique. Make your website different from what your competitions have designed. Let your website stand out from the rest.

Therefore, what is clear here is that you cannot build a successful and recognizable brand by failing to create a unique website. Which also means that unique content is essential. Web design is all about creating the right image about your brand in the minds and eyes of all your existing as well as prospective customers.
